Hernias happen when the muscles of your abdomen pull apart enough for a small bit of your intestines to poke through, causing a bulge under the skin. If this happens near your belly button you have an umbilical hernia. If it is in your groin (inguinal area) you have an inguinal hernia.

WebThe Inferior Epigastric artery is prominently visualized during laparoscopic preperitoneal dissection of groin hernia. Implication. It forms the lateral border of the Hasselbach’s triangle. Identifying these vessels differentiates between indirect and direct inguinal hernia.
